Osca Environmental Services Ltd

Thainstone Business Centre, Inverurie AB515TB Inverurie , Aberdeenshire, United Kingdom United Kingdom
  • Profile: Osca Environmental Services Ltd is a Oil and Gas Exploration Supplies and Services company located at Inverurie , Aberdeenshire,, United Kingdom United Kingdom, address is Thainstone Business Centre, Inverurie, Inverurie , Aberdeenshire, AB515TB UK, postcode is AB515TB, you can contact Osca Environmental Services Ltd by phone 441467625050
Please share as much information as you can about Osca Environmental Services Ltd so other users can benefit from your comment.